Are VIP Points Actually Worth Anything?

This is the question that matters. We calculated the effective cashback rate at each casino by tracking how many points we earned per £100 wagered and what those points could be redeemed for. The results varied significantly.

At PlayOJO, the OJOplus cashback gives you around 1% of every bet back as real cash. That isn’t huge, but it’s real money with no strings attached. At Sky Vegas, the points system gives you roughly around 0% cashback value if you redeem for free spins. At 32Red, the rate is closer to around 0% but with wagering attached to the redemptions.

Some operators have VIP shops that look impressive but are actually quite stingy. We found one site where 10,000 points could be exchanged for £5 in bonus credit with 40x wagering. That is effectively worth pennies. Always check the redemption rate before committing to a loyalty programme.

How to Maximise Your Rewards

  1. Focus on wager-free rewards. Points that convert to cash or free spins with no playthrough are far more valuable.
  2. Check the expiry period. Some shops make points expire after 30 days of inactivity, which is harsh.
  3. Play games with high contribution rates. Slots typically count 100% toward point accumulation, while table games may only count 10%.
  4. Set a monthly deposit limit. The GamCare helpline (0808 8020 133) recommends this for responsible play.
  5. Use GamStop if you need a break. National self-exclusion is available at gamstop.co.uk.
